The Legend of the Khukuri: Strength, Courage, and Protection

Khukuris are not merely weapons; they are imbued with cultural significance. In Nepali folklore, the blade is often associated with the god Bhairava, a fierce manifestation of Shiva, representing power, destruction, and ultimately, protection. The curved shape is said to represent the crescent moon, while the distinctive "chok" (the fuller) on the blade is believed to aid in drawing blood to the enemy whilst increasing the sharpness of the knife's cut. The Khukuri's role in countless battles and its steadfast presence alongside the Gurkha soldiers in war has solidified its status as a symbol of valor and strength.
